Some wings that big, i.e. RE Amemiya's actually ARE functional--but you have to consider that his cars are pushing over 400 hp so it is needed. I doubt any car would be going fast enough, legally, on the street to need something that big.

Personally, unless I'm tracking the car, I would just use the stock spoiler--and even if I am tracking, Id use an 2" extension for the stock spoiler. Sevens look great as is without too much aero mods.
